The potential privacy implications are especially salient after we contemplate the demographics of individuals that use dating apps. While 30% of U.S. adults had tried online courting in 2019, that percentage rises to 55% for LGBTQ+ adults and 48% for people ages 18 to 29. Since dating websites and apps gather, course of, and share information from a larger share of those individuals, they could bear disproportionate effects of any privacy or security breaches.
